The word “quantum” originates from Latin, meaning “how much” or “a quantity”. In the context of physics and science, the term “quantum” refers to the basic unit or portion of a physical quantity, such as energy, matter, or radiation.

In more precise terms, a quantum is the smallest amount of a physical quantity that can exist independently or be individually distinguished from other occurrences of the same quantity. This concept is fundamental to understanding many phenomena in the physical and natural sciences, including:

1. Quantum mechanics: The study of the behavior of particles at the atomic and subatomic level, where energy and matter are quantized into discrete packets or quanta.
2. Quantum field theory: The study of the behavior of particles in terms of fields, where the fields are quantized into quanta.
3. Quantum computing: The study of computers that use quantum-mechanical phenomena, such as superposition and entanglement, to perform calculations.
